Theodóra Alfreðsdóttir (born 1986) is an Icelandic product designer based in London. She studied product design at Iceland University of the Arts (2012) and pursued her master's degree in Design Products at the Royal College of Art in London (2015). Collaborations, both with other designers/makers and with companies and brands, are a large part of Theodóra's work and practice. Alongside her self-initiated and commissioned work, Theodóra has been a visiting tutor at Iceland University of the Arts since 2016 and an associate lecturer at Goldsmiths University since 2021.

In her design studio, Theodóra creates stories using objects as her medium. Her work explores the stories an object can tell and finds ways to express them through the object itself. In doing so, she is fascinated by how a product can show its own manufacturing process. She often sees a product as documentation of what happened between the machine, the tool, the craftsman, and the material. It can even communicate something about the origin of a material or a past life. For Theodóra, this approach to product design often leads to the discovery of unexpected qualities. Her work also encourages people to reconsider our material world and explore value in a different way.
